How to prepare for a job interview at Caterplus

Know Your Community

Before the interview, take some time to understand the community you’ll be serving. Caterplus focuses on creating warm spaces for the over-55s, so think about how you can contribute to that atmosphere. Bring examples of how you've engaged with similar communities in the past.

Showcase Your Culinary Passion

As a Chef Manager, your love for food should shine through. Prepare to discuss your favourite dishes and how you source fresh ingredients. Maybe even share a personal story about a meal that brought people together – it’ll show your passion for creating memorable dining experiences.

Team Management Skills

Caterplus values teamwork, so be ready to talk about your experience managing kitchen teams. Think of specific examples where you’ve successfully led a team, resolved conflicts, or improved kitchen efficiency. Highlighting your leadership style will demonstrate that you’re the right fit for their environment.

Prepare Questions

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the role and the company culture. Ask about their approach to menu planning or how they engage with the community. This shows your genuine interest and helps you assess if it's the right place for you too.
